According to the Service Manual, after replacement of sensor, "Using the diagnostic FDRS scan tool, follow the on screen prompts to run and reset the outside air temperature sensor learned values."
I don't have FDRS to do this.
Replaced my sensor that was stuck at 63 degrees. The new sensor seems to take some driving around to be correct. I did not disconnect the battery ground cable.
